Is there a recommended maximum length for URLs when creating a new inner page? For example: www.mydomainname/howlonghere?.html
I think the maximimum that IE can handle is something like 2000 characters. Of course, they should never be that long. In reality, your webserver might choke on anything above 255 characters. IMO, a reaslistic maximum should be around 100 characters
